(a)As used in this act:
(i)"Calendar year" means the twelve (12) calendar
months beginning January 1 and ending December 31;
(ii)"Dealer" means all persons engaged in the
business or vocation of manufacturing, buying, selling, trading,
dealing, destroying, disposing of, storing or salvaging
vehicles, or secondhand or used vehicle parts, equipment,
attachments, accessories or appurtenances common to or a part of
vehicles;
(iii)"Department" means the Wyoming department of
transportation;
(iv)"Driver" means the person operating, driving or
in control of a vehicle;
(v)"Officer" means any duly constituted peace
officer of this state, or of any town, city or county in this
state;
(vi)"Owner" means as provided by W.S.
31-5-102(a)(xxvi);
